What is Climate Change?
Climate change refers to long-term changes in the temperature, precipitation, and weather patterns of the Earth. While natural factors like volcanic activity and solar radiation can influence climate, human activities, particularly the burning of fossil fuels, deforestation, and industrial processes, have significantly accelerated the warming of the planet. This process, known as global warming, is causing the Earth’s average temperature to rise, which in turn leads to a variety of environmental issues.
Global Impacts of Climate Change
- Rising Sea Levels: One of the most visible effects of climate change is the rising sea levels. As global temperatures increase, ice sheets and glaciers are melting at an alarming rate, contributing to higher sea levels. This threatens low-lying coastal areas, leading to flooding, loss of land, and the displacement of millions of people.
- Extreme Weather Events: The increase in global temperatures has also been linked to more frequent and severe weather events such as hurricanes, droughts, floods, and heatwaves. For instance, the intensity and frequency of hurricanes in the Atlantic Ocean have increased in recent years, causing devastating damage to communities and economies.
- Loss of Biodiversity: Climate change is also causing shifts in ecosystems. Rising temperatures and altered rainfall patterns are putting stress on various species, leading to habitat loss and a decline in biodiversity. Coral reefs, for example, are extremely vulnerable to warming oceans, which leads to coral bleaching and the death of marine life.
- Impacts on Agriculture: As weather patterns become more unpredictable, crops and livestock are suffering. Extended droughts or sudden floods can destroy crops, and pests and diseases thrive in warmer climates. This not only affects food security but also contributes to rising prices for essential goods.
- Health Risks: Climate change also poses significant health risks. Heatwaves are becoming more frequent, leading to heat-related illnesses and deaths. Additionally, changes in temperature and precipitation can expand the range of diseases spread by mosquitoes, such as malaria and dengue fever.
Mitigation Strategies for Climate Change
Although the effects of climate change are severe, it’s not too late to take action. Mitigation strategies focus on reducing or preventing the causes of climate change, particularly the emission of greenhouse gases (GHGs). Here are some of the most effective strategies being employed around the world:
- Transition to Renewable Energy: The shift from fossil fuels to renewable energy sources like solar, wind, and hydropower is one of the most crucial steps in mitigating climate change. Renewable energy sources produce little to no greenhouse gases, unlike coal, oil, and natural gas, which contribute significantly to global warming.
- Energy Efficiency: Improving energy efficiency is another key strategy. By using less energy to perform the same tasks, we can reduce the overall demand for fossil fuels. This can be achieved through better building insulation, more efficient appliances, and the development of low-energy technologies.
- Carbon Capture and Storage (CCS): Carbon capture and storage technologies are being developed to capture carbon dioxide emissions from power plants and other industrial sources and store them underground. While still in the early stages, CCS has the potential to reduce emissions significantly.
- Reforestation and Afforestation: Trees play a critical role in absorbing carbon dioxide from the atmosphere. Reforestation (planting trees in deforested areas) and afforestation (planting trees in areas that were not previously forested) are vital to removing excess CO2 from the atmosphere. Protecting existing forests is just as important to prevent further emissions.
- Sustainable Agriculture: Agriculture accounts for a significant portion of global emissions, especially through methane from livestock and nitrous oxide from fertilizers. Sustainable farming practices, such as reducing chemical use, promoting plant-based diets, and improving soil health, can help mitigate these emissions while also protecting the environment.
- Climate Policy and International Cooperation: Governments worldwide are recognizing the need for action through climate policies and international agreements like the Paris Agreement. This global accord aims to limit global temperature rise to below 2°C and pursue efforts to limit the increase to 1.5°C, signaling a collective commitment to tackling climate change.
- Adapting to Climate Change: While mitigation is crucial, adaptation to the inevitable impacts of climate change is equally important. Communities must prepare for extreme weather, rising sea levels, and other climate-related threats through better infrastructure, disaster preparedness, and community-based adaptation strategies.

The Role of Individuals in Combating Climate Change
While governments and industries play a significant role in mitigating climate change, individuals can make a difference too. Simple actions like reducing energy consumption, driving less, recycling, and supporting sustainable brands can have a positive impact. By making eco-friendly choices in our daily lives, we contribute to the global effort to combat climate change.
